5. Lightweight Wheels

Replacing stock wheels with lightweight aftermarket options can reduce the overall weight of the Nissan Leaf. This reduction in weight can lead to improved acceleration and efficiency, as less energy is required to move the vehicle. Lightweight wheels also contribute to better handling and responsiveness on the road.
